Sailboats prey on shoal of sardines. A distinctive feature is a tall sailing ship and a long first dorsal fin like a sail. Sailboat predator is active and can reach the speed of 100 km / h. During a series of tests carried out in the fishing camp of Long Key, Florida, USA, sailboat sailed 91 meters for 3 seconds, which is equivalent to the speed of 109 km / h. (Photo by Fabrice Guerin):
